What forces layout/reflow. The comprehensive list.

What forces layout / reflow

All of the below properties or methods, when requested/called in JavaScript, will trigger the browser to synchronously calculate the style and layout*. This is also called reflow or layout thrashing, and is common performance bottleneck.

Generally, all APIs that synchronously provide layout metrics will trigger forced reflow / layout. Read on for additional cases and details.

Element APIs

Getting box metrics
  • elem.offsetLeft, elem.offsetTop, elem.offsetWidth, elem.offsetHeight, elem.offsetParent

Installing SSHPass

Installing SSHPASS

SSHPass is a tiny utility, which allows you to provide the ssh password without using the prompt. This will very helpful for scripting. SSHPass is not good to use in multi-user environment. If you use SSHPass on your development machine, it don't do anything evil.

Installing on Ubuntu

apt-get install sshpass

Learning Python for QA automation tasks

Hello all,

In this gist you may find resources in Russian/English which could be useful for writing Python script for test automation tasks.

What Python runtime I should use?

While Python 3.x (>=3.3) is reccomended for new project development it much better and easier to go with a bit older but rock-solid Python 2.x (>=2.7) for test automation.

Some Python packages comes with binary modules and it much easier to use 32-bit Python under Windows due to this reason.
